10 Best Houston Bars & Restaurants for Mexican Food & Margaritas | Eater

"Tex-Mex comfort food at its best. La Tapatia specializes in the kinds of plates you most likely grew up loving, from large plates of enchiladas and quesadillas with a healthy portion of beans and rice on the side to fajitas and seafood dishes. Naturally, there’s a great selection of margaritas. (Their half-frozen, half-rocks version is a must.) As an added bonus, it’s open until 3 a.m. and the late-night people-watching is A+." - Marcy Franklin

I ordered the Mole Chicken Meal earlier, which was great, very good texture in every part of the meal and very tasty overall. The chicken quarter was juicy, tender and cooked right. The mole sauce smothering it all was flavorful with a fruity, muddy taste and velvety, creamy texture. I prefer Mexican mole to be a bit spicier n more chocolatey, but it was still very good imo and would get it again with this chicken leg. The rice was loose, sticky-grained, fresh n aromatic. The refried beans were very good in taste with a chunky texture as they should be. I can't stand when places give the really smooth kind making me wonder if they just made them from a can instead of making them in house. The red salsa n chips were very good. I didn't care for the side of corn tortillas here, but no biggie since the rice n beans were great. I didn't get a sangria this time for my drink here, but they do make them really good from what I remember, kinda tart n very refreshing.

I stopped by La Tapatia for a late, last minute lunch. The lunch specials are available from 11:00 a.m. to 3:00 p.m. Typically during happy hour, evenings, and late nights you can expect to be welcomed to a festive and jovial atmosphere, but lunch was much more refrained and subdued. It was nice being able to just relax and dine in the casual and unpretentious dinning room before jumping back onto my list of tasks to complete. I had the Burrito Plater stuffed with ground beef, beans, lettuce, tomatoes, etc., topped with a tasty queso and meat sauce. There was a side of rice, and a dab of guacamole. For the price, the lunch proportions were sufficient and the service was prompt. Other sound choices on the lunch menu include flautas, enchilada plates/combos, sizzling fajitas, and the option of ordering off of the full menu. Regardless of if you are seeking a low key lunch, or a fun and jovial happy hour, La Tapatia is a place to keep in mind.
